Nine first-year UT San Antonio students are the new champions of the Siemens Immersive Design Challenge. This global engineering competition began with more than 1,900 participants, and after three rounds of competition the all-freshman team stood out from the rest.
Competing as Team 210 Robotics, the students met the competition’s challenge with an innovative sustainability solution that uses immersive engineering—a technique that connects the virtual and physical worlds.

The students gave one final presentation to an executive judging panel today, demonstrating their autonomous robotic project, RoboRowdy. The robot aims to improve mid- to large-scale 3D print farms by automating part removal and building plate cleaning and print restarts.
In April, their project earned the team a spot as a finalist in this global competition, a historic feat, as they became the first and only United States university team to reach this level of the competition.

As finalists, the students earned invitations in June to attend the Siemens annual convention in Detroit, MI, Realize LIVE 2026. The event draws global technology companies, giving the students prime exposure to future professional pathways.

Founded by White and Elizondo, the team came together in the Honors College’s Guadalupe Hall. Other members of the team include Andrew Romo, Darik Pratt, Jiseo Chon, Dyshana Torres Rivera, Vian Chen, Roman Benavides and Gray Samiengo.
As the undergraduates prepare for next year’s competition, they’re turning this achievement into a foundation for the future by creating a multidisciplinary student organization that will foster collaboration, encourage innovation, and support the next generation of robotics leaders.
